Definition
- 1Gasse, die von einem Hauptweg/einer Hauptstraße abgeht
Recorded use
Wiktionary examplesThese source excerpts show how Seitengasse appears in context. They illustrate usage; the definition above remains the entry’s reference meaning.
„Unter den kleinen Hotels in den Seitengassen wählte ich lange, ehe ich eins fand, das verwahrlost genug aussah, um für einen Unterschlupf passend zu sein.“
„Ich wich in die nächstbeste stille Seitengasse aus und verlor mich im arabischen Viertel.“
